I was laying under my M-37 replacing the old surgical tubing I use to vent my diffs' and crank cases. Just as I was heading into nap mode, I wondered why I couldn't flip the rear axle to move the third member closer to the center output on the transfer case. This would mean stripping the axle housing, welding spring perches on the other side and installing the third member opposite of its stock position.The only concerns I could come up with would be: Still needing a new rear driveshaft and distorting the axle tubes when welding the perches on. Anyone thought about this before? ever tried it?
I want to stick with this axle housing as opposed to a centered because it has shafts from Daniel Tibus.
